Summary

Razo Raul operating as a sole owner is licensed in California under CSLB number 930876. The license was first issued in 2009, putting the business at 17 years on the active CSLB roster. It carries a single CSLB classification: B — General Building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Philadelphia Indemnity Insurance Company and an exempt workers' compensation status (no employees on payroll). The business is based in Spring Valley, in San Diego County, California.
